Handover note — Crumbwheel order cutoffs.

Welcome aboard. The bakery cutoff rule in Crumbwheel closes same-day orders at 14:00 local to each storefront, not UTC — this has bitten us twice. Holiday overrides live in the calendar service and take precedence silently, so always check there first when a cutoff looks wrong. To unlock the calendar service's admin console after a restart, enter the recovery passphrase below.

vault phrase of bagap-bahaf = silion-pelox-sorox-casdor-quenwyn-fraax-eliox-praael-kelion-quenvan-kasox-rusael-norius-belvan

**Handover: Skylark websocket reconnect bug — Orel to Demne**

Demne, summary for future maintainers: the Skylark client drops reconnect attempts when the server closes with code 1012 during deploys. The backoff timer resets incorrectly because the close handler fires twice; see the guard I added in the reconnect module, still behind a feature flag. Staging repro steps are in the test plan doc. To open the flag-management console in staging, use the recovery passphrase noted right below.

vault phrase of tajeg-tageg = pelix-druix-holius-briael-zorwyn-frawyn-fraox-norok-drueth-aldiel

Q: How does Lumenarc sandbox user-supplied formulas?

A: Formulas submitted through the Lumenarc sheet editor are parsed into a restricted AST and executed inside the Fennick sandbox, with no filesystem, network, or clock access. Evaluation is capped at 200ms and 16MB per cell. If the sandbox image itself becomes corrupted, maintainers must restore it from the sealed snapshot archive. Unlocking that archive requires the recovery passphrase, which is kept directly below this entry.

strongbox words: fraath-isteth